Violinist, Emily has accomplished a lot at the age of 13.  She enjoys most of all playing violin, gymnastics, dancing, acting, reading, writing, learning, and getting involved in ways to help others.  Emily is 1st violinist in her school orchestra and is also in a chamber group.  She has done multiple violin solos at school concerts, a teaching program for young children, at a restaurant called Woody's, and at a concert in New Orleans.  She has also taught herself to play piano!  Emily has helped families with disabled children, donated her hair to Locks Of Love for children with cancer, and has done a huge project to help an orchestra in New Orleans for her Bat Mitzvah.  She was on the Maury Povitch show at the age of 11.  She is very motivated and eager to help and learn. 

Emily appeared in many local and national newspapers and magazines for this project, (you can see them in the "Glimpse of the News" section.) One of them being the: American Profile Magazine which comes with most newspapers every week.  She was shown under the "Home Town Heroes" section.  Emily was also on the channel Nickelodeon, in Nick News talking about her New Orleans project and trip there.   It was an incredible experience!  The show aired throughout the whole month of August.
